So, what's the big deal with semi-transparent stains? Well, they offer the best of both worlds. They provide color and protection but don't hide the intricate grain patterns and knots that make wood so unique. This means you get a look that's both rich and natural.

For the DIY beginner, this is a fantastic starting point. Unlike opaque paints that can show brush marks easily, semi-transparent stains are generally more forgiving. They blend in beautifully, and any slight imperfections are often masked by the wood's existing texture. It’s a great way to gain confidence and achieve a professional-looking result without a ton of experience.

Sherwin Williams offers a wonderful range of colors. Think classic, earthy tones like Cedarwood Bluff and Driftwood Gray for a timeless appeal. Or perhaps you're feeling a bit bolder with shades like Deep Mahogany for a warm, inviting feel, or even a subtle green like Forest Bark to blend with nature. Each color has a way of highlighting the wood's grain differently, so it's worth exploring the options.

Need a little variation? Some stains offer slightly different undertones. You might find a gray that leans a bit blue, or a brown with reddish hints. These subtle differences can have a big impact on the final look, so always test your chosen color on a small, inconspicuous area of your wood project first.

Getting started is simpler than you might think. First, make sure your wood surface is clean and dry. Give it a good scrub to remove any dirt, mildew, or old finishes. Then, grab a quality brush or applicator pad. Apply the stain in the direction of the wood grain, working in manageable sections. Remember, it’s usually better to apply thin, even coats rather than one thick one. You can always add another layer if needed.
